Welcome, Curtis. Glad you came. Tracy Mickley (usaknifemaker) sells good contact wheels. He puts out plans for a DIY no-weld 2x72 grinder and carries many of the parts. I think Rob Frink at Beaumont also carries some.
 
Grizzly tools 10" wheel about ---------------------------75.00 With shipping
High speed bearings from the bearing shop on ebay---------20.94 shipped
Machining and pressing the bearings in-------------------30.00
